這是怎麼回事。我有一個視圖模型,我稱之爲webclient,並用項目填充可觀察的集合。我需要在兩個不同的頁面中有兩個不同的列表框,但是與viewmodel具有相同的ItemsSource。如何限制兩個列表框之一中的項目數量而不影響其他項目?我試圖使用.Take(限制)到正在創建項目的視圖模型中,但影響兩個列表框。 更新 視圖模型 public class MainViewModel : INoti
我使用的ObservableCollection作爲我的ListBox組件的的ItemSource: 但控制的行爲不是適當的給我。我已經向下滾動到我收藏中的第一次發生,但不是最後一次。 樣品名單是:1,1,2,3,4,5,6,7,8,9,11,22,33,1 當你enetr最後1個您組件向上滾動到第一個:)。這不是我渴望的。 請指教。這裏的組件代碼: public class MyListBox
我有一個應用程序,我需要在System.Web.UI.ListBox中顯示一個函數的字符串輸出列表。要獲得一個字符串輸出(執行該函數)需要一些時間。我在將字符串輸出添加到列表框後生成它。問題是,我的問題是應用程序等待整個時間(直到所有項目計算並添加到listbox),最後一次顯示整個列表框(在等待很長一段時間後,由於生成大量輸出字符串所需的時間)。請有人幫我在頁面上添加listox項目,謝謝。 p